Captivate 4 and Transitions

I feel like a real a$$ having to ask this question, but how do I turn off ALL transitions? I have no transitions selected as the default in Preferences. I have a project. It has one slide. On the slide is one circle, which I created using the Drawing Objects. I have no transitions set for the slide and no transitions set for the circle. Yet still, when I preview it or publish it, the circle fades in and then fades out. What am I missing?

The entire project can also have a fade in and fade out transition.

Check under Preferences > Start and End to see if fades are set.
